What Does It Mean When a Guy Moves His Chair Closer to Yours?

Body language is a powerful form of non-verbal communication, often revealing a person's true feelings and intentions. When a guy shifts his chair nearer to yours, it can indicate a variety of things depending on the context, his personality, and the overall situation. While there's no one-size-fits-all answer, certain common interpretations can help you make sense of his actions.

Possible Interpretations of a Guy Moving His Chair Closer

  • Interest or Attraction: One of the most common reasons is romantic or sexual interest. Moving closer can be an unconscious attempt to create intimacy and signal that he's attracted to you.
  • Desire for Better Communication: If he's genuinely interested in what you're saying, he might move closer to hear you better or to engage more fully in the conversation.
  • Comfort and Familiarity: Some people are naturally more tactile or physically expressive. For them, moving closer might simply be a sign of comfort or friendliness.
  • Attempt to Establish Connection: In some cases, he may be trying to establish a stronger connection or break the physical distance to make the interaction more personal.
  • Sign of Flirting: Moving closer can be a subtle flirtation cue, especially if combined with other positive body language signals like eye contact, smiling, or leaning in.
  • Social or Cultural Norms: Depending on cultural background, proximity may be a standard way of showing engagement or respect.

Context Matters

While the above interpretations provide a general idea, context is critical in understanding body language cues accurately. Consider the environment, your relationship with the guy, and the nature of your interaction:

  • In a Romantic Setting: If you're on a date or in a setting where romantic interest is possible, a move closer is often a positive sign indicating attraction.
  • In a Professional or Casual Setting: In work-related or casual conversations, it might simply mean he's engaged or interested in the topic.
  • Body Language Complementing the Move: Look for other signals like eye contact, smiling, touching, or mirroring your actions to better interpret his intentions.

Signs That Indicate Romantic Interest

Moving his chair closer is just one of many behavioral cues that can suggest romantic interest. Pay attention to accompanying signs such as:

  • Prolonged eye contact or frequent glances
  • Smiling warmly or laughing at your jokes
  • Mirroring your gestures or posture
  • Touching his face, neck, or hands while talking
  • Finding reasons to initiate physical contact, like a light touch on your arm
  • Maintaining a relaxed, open posture directed toward you
  • Engaging in flirtatious conversation or teasing

What It Might Not Mean

It's equally important to recognize that a guy moving his chair closer doesn't always indicate romantic interest. Sometimes, it simply reflects:

  • A desire to hear better in a noisy environment
  • Comfort in close proximity due to personality traits
  • Attempting to be polite or respectful in certain social settings
  • Unconscious habits without deeper meaning

How to Handle It

If you're curious about his intentions or interested yourself, knowing how to respond can make a big difference. Here are some tips on handling the situation:

  • Observe the Overall Body Language: Look for other signs of interest or discomfort. If he’s making prolonged eye contact, smiling, and leaning in, it’s likely more than just proximity.
  • Mirror His Actions: Subtly mirroring his body language can create a sense of connection and comfort.
  • Maintain Open and Confident Posture: Keep your body language relaxed and approachable, signaling you're receptive but also in control.
  • Use Verbal Cues: If comfortable, you can respond with light humor or questions to gauge his intentions better.
  • Set Boundaries if Needed: If you feel uncomfortable with his closeness, politely but firmly indicate your boundaries, such as shifting slightly away or stating your preference.
  • Trust Your Intuition: Ultimately, your feelings and instincts are valuable. If you sense genuine interest, consider engaging further; if not, maintain your boundaries.
